Before anything else: what is an emergency
- An ambulance is 10177. From a mobile phone, 112 reaches an emergency operator. Police is 10111. These are the numbers to use, not a hospital switchboard or a clinic’s booking line.
- No one may be refused emergency medical treatment. Section 27 of the Constitution guarantees it, and that applies to private facilities regardless of medical scheme status or ability to pay.
- Chest pain, stroke symptoms, difficulty breathing, heavy bleeding and a suspected overdose are emergencies. With a stroke, treatment options narrow by the hour, so speed genuinely changes outcomes.
- Say where you are first. Give the location before the symptoms, because a call that drops after the address still gets help moving.
- Do not drive yourself. If there is any chance of losing consciousness, an ambulance is safer for you and for everyone else on the road.
For poisoning, keep the container and phone a poisons information helpline or get to an emergency department. For a mental health crisis, the Suicide Crisis Helpline on 0800 567 567 answers around the clock.
Complaints and escalation
If a first call does not resolve the matter, escalate through the facility’s own complaints process first. Complaints about care at a health establishment go to the Health Ombud on 080 911 6472, and complaints about a practitioner’s conduct go to the relevant statutory council.
Keep a short written log of each contact: the date, the channel you used, the name of the agent and the reference number. Most health complaint processes ask for exactly that history, and having it ready is usually the difference between a fast resolution and starting over.
Avoiding fake Gansbaai Kliniek contact numbers
Contact details for well known South African brands are a common target for impersonation. Numbers that look official appear in search ads, social media replies and cloned websites, and the person answering is not Gansbaai Kliniek.

- Gansbaai Kliniek will never ask you for your full card number, PIN, CVV, online banking password or a one time PIN. Nobody legitimate needs those to help you.
- Treat any caller who creates urgency, asks you to install remote access software, or asks you to move money to a safe account as fraudulent, and end the call.
- If you are unsure whether a call was genuine, hang up and dial the official number yourself rather than calling back a number the caller gave you.

Is there a cost to calling these numbers?
South African 0860 and 0861 numbers are charged at a share-call or standard rate depending on your provider, and 0800 numbers are toll free from a landline. Calls from a mobile are billed at your own operator’s rate, so check your plan if cost matters.
